Emile durkheim theory of structural functionalism he says religion has a cohesive e ect on societies. Basically religion is needed for society to function. This can be applied to any social group, eg. sports can be seen as a religion (because of the fans). Weber saw religion as a form of capitalism since christianity (particularly. Calvinism), promoted hard work which saw economic success as a sign of a favourable status in god"s eyes. Marx saw religion as people to escape from the injustices of a capitalist society eg. having to sell their labour as a commodity, not owning the means of production and therefore the capitalists control the workers.
